In the summer of 2006, Lucas Foglia set out to photograph a network of people who had left cities and suburbs to live off the grid in the rural southeastern United States. Many were motivated by environmental concerns, others were driven by religious beliefs or predictions of economic collapse. While everyone he photographed was working to maintain self-sufficiency, none lived in complete isolation from the mainstream. Instead, they chose which parts of the modern world to embrace and which to leave behind. The body of work, made over a five-year period, is gathered together in the artist’s first book, A Natural Order – a stunning collection that explores a human relationship with wilderness and the persistent libertarianism of the American psyche. Foglia's photographs, at once iconic and intimate, provoke us to take a candid look at individuals whose chosen lifestyles seem both exotic and unnervingly close to home.
A Natural Order is a photography book by Lucas Foglia, published by Nazraeli Press in 2012. The work features photographs that are described as both iconic and intimate, capturing individuals whose chosen lifestyles appear simultaneously exotic and close to home. The publication includes an anonymously authored and illustrated 'zine titled 'wildlifoodin', which serves as part journal and part survival manual, evoking the style of the Whole Earth Catalog. Foglia's work has been featured in various publications including Aperture Magazine, the New York Times Magazine, and the Washington Post Magazine.
